摘要:本文目录导读:一、无缝不断升级的其其重要性性二、无缝不断升级的利用策略三、无缝不断升级的利用方案四、小心事项Juic网页游戏eFSCSID网页游戏river在四款专为Kuber网页游戏netes部分设计,综合解析JuiceFS 反恐精英I Driver的无缝更新利用策略和方式改变 综合解析有这类积累流流程中
本文目录导读:
- 一、无缝不断升级的其其重要性性
- 二、无缝不断升级的利用策略
- 三、无缝不断升级的利用方案
- 四、小心事项
JuiceFS CSI Driver在四款专为Kubernetes部分设计的容器存储接口(Container Storage Interface)驱动,它使Kubernetes集群帮助你你 无缝利用高性能的JuiceFS文件软件系统,下述是对JuiceFS CSI Driver无缝不断升级利用策略与方案的全面解析:
一、无缝不断升级的其其重要性性
在Kubernetes人文环境 中,存储的管理是有个核心不需要不需要最终解决 ,中国传统的不断升级利用,如彻底挂载应用Pod利用滚动不断升级或手动重建Mount Pod,通通常造成业务中断,很大影响消费用户真实体验,顺利完成JuiceFS CSI Driver的无缝不断升级,即在应用不停服的现象发生发生下不断升级Mount Pod,还具其其重要性意义,它不仅仅帮助你你 减小业务中断的风险,帮助你你 够帮助你 大大提高软件系统的可靠性和稳定性。
二、无缝不断升级的利用策略
JuiceFS CSI Driver全部支持两种无缝不断升级利用:二进制不断升级和Pod重建不断升级。
1、二进制不断升级
适用场景:仅帮助你你 不断升级JuiceFS每个客户端二进制文件时。
不断升级流程:
1. 在触发平滑不断不断升级,CSI Node启动有个利用新镜像的Job。
2. Job将彻底JuiceFS每个客户端二进制文件复制到Mount Pod中。
3. Job顺利完成后,CSI Node向Mount Pod发送SIGHUP信号。
4. Mount Pod接收到信号后,保存当前的I/O请求整体状态各类信息到临时文件,并退出专业服务进程。
5. JuiceFS每个客户端的守护进程用彻底二进制文件彻底启动专业服务进程。
6. 彻底专业服务进程从守护进程获取当前的FUSE文件描述符(fd),仍然其他处理 I/O请求。
优点:速度快 快、风险小,不帮助你你 重建Pod。
缺点:没有更新Mount Pod的任何配置。
2、Pod重建不断升级
适用场景:帮助你你 更新Mount Pod的镜像、挂载参数或资源配置时。
不断升级流程:
1. 在触发平滑不断不断升级,CSI Node先启动有个与新Mount Pod相同配置的空Job,以备好将新镜像拉取到节点上。
2. Job顺利完成后,CSI Node向和新Mount Pod发送SIGHUP信号。
3. 和新Mount Pod接收到信号后,保存当前的I/O整体状态各类信息到临时文件,并退出,之际 Mount Pod变为Complete整体状态。
4. CSI Node按照ConfigMap流程中 配置,创建彻底Mount Pod。
5. 彻底Mount Pod启动后,读取临时文件流程中 左边整体状态各类信息,仍然其他处理 通常的I/O请求。
6. 彻底Mount Pod从CSI Node获取当前的FUSE fd。
优点:帮助你你 更新Mount Pod的任何配置,的的镜像、挂载参数和资源配置。
缺点:帮助你你 集群人文环境 复杂,重建Pod的积累流流程中 流程中 以是再存在基础出错的风险。
三、无缝不断升级的利用方案
1、不断升级前的备好
* 备份其其重要性数据结果,确保数据结果的安全性。
* 确保集群人文环境 稳定,规避 在不断升级积累积累流流程中 再存在基础太意外现象发生发生。
2、不断升级把时间的选则
* 专家建议 在负载较低的通常利用不断升级灵活操作,以减小对业务的很大影响。
3、版本兼容性
* 确保不断不断升级的JuiceFS CSI Driver版本与JuiceFS每个客户端版本兼容,规避 再存在基础版本不兼容造成的不需要不需要最终解决 。
4、触发不断升级
* JuiceFS CSI Driver的无缝不断升级帮助你你 在CSI Dashboard或kubectl插件中触发。
+ 在CSI Dashboard中,点击“配置”按钮,更新Mount Pod帮助你你 不断升级和新镜像版本,在Mount Pod的详情页,选则“Pod重建不断升级”或“二进制不断升级”按钮,触发平滑不断升级,不断升级积累积累流流程中 ,帮助你你 在页面上查看不断升级进度,不断升级顺利完成后,页面会自动跳转到彻底Mount Pod的详情页。
+ 利用JuiceFS kubectl plugin触发Mount Pod的平滑不断升级,利用下述命令利用Pod重建不断升级或二进制不断升级:kubectl jfs upgrade <mount-pod-name> --recreate
(Pod重建不断升级)或kubectl jfs upgrade <mount-pod-name>
(二进制不断升级)。
5、监控与日志
* 在不断升级积累积累流流程中 ,密切加关注集群的监控指标和日志各类信息,以便及时偶然发现并不需要最终解决 不需要不需要最终解决 。
四、小心事项
1、在利用无缝不断升级通常,专家建议 仔细阅读JuiceFS CSI Driver的官方文档,深入了解不断升级的具体情况步骤和小心事项。
2、帮助你你 在不断升级积累积累流流程中 遇见不需要不需要最终解决 ,帮助你你 查阅JuiceFS的社区论坛或联络中国传统技术 全部支持寻求帮助你。
JuiceFS CSI Driver的无缝不断升级利用策略与方案的的选则最合适的不断升级利用、备好不断升级前的备好工作会、选则适当的不断升级把时间、确保版本兼容性、触发不断升级的的监控与日志等中国传统技术 中国传统技术 层面,利用遵循这类策略和方案,帮助你你 顺利完成JuiceFS CSI Driver的无缝不断升级,大大提高软件系统的可靠性和稳定性。